(ANSA) - Rome, March 7 - Beppe Grillo has said there is a
danger Italy will be ruled by "street violence" if his
anti-establishment 5-Star Movement (M5S) fails to change how the
country is governed."I have channeled all the rage in this movement," Grillo, whose movement holds the balance of power in parliament after a stunning performances in last month's inconclusive general election, told Time magazine.
"They should thank us one by one. If we fail, Italy will be led by violence in the streets".
